UPDATED: VDM, Adeyanju, Others Arrive NASS As Bobrisky Fails To Show
The probe into the reported N15 million bribery case involving the controversial figure Idris Okuneye, popularly known as Bobrisky, has recently begun within the House.
This inquiry is being conducted by the House Committees on Financial Crimes and Reformatory Institutions and was initiated at approximately 2:05 p.m. with the presence of Martins Otse, also recognized as VeryDarkMan, along with his legal representative, Deji Adeyanju.
The situation arose when VeryDarkMan released a voice recording allegedly featuring Bobrisky, where it was claimed that officials from the EFCC demanded N15 million to dismiss the money laundering charge against him.
In the recording, Bobrisky also asserted that he avoided serving time in prison following his conviction, mentioning that an individual referred to as his godfather arranged for him to fulfill his sentence in a facility other than a traditional jail, thereby raising concerns regarding the Nigerian Correctional Services’ involvement.
During the time of this report, it is noted that Idris Okuneye (Bobrisky) himself was not present at the hearing, with his lawyer appearing on his behalf instead.
